The Maintenance Officer will be required to attend to duties that improve the day to day lives of our residents and employees and ensure a safe and clean living and working environment.
Key Responsibilities
Attend to duties that improve the day to day lives of our residents and employees and ensure a safe and clean living and working environment.
Various tasks as requested by the Maintenance Supervisor or relevant manager including preventative and reactive maintenance of site and equipment, inspections, liaising with consultants, gardening and landscaping.
Ensure a resident centred approach
What you bring
Possess previous experience in a relevant trade industry.
Commitment to continuous quality improvement
Self-motivated and able to work in a team
Good communication skills, written and oral
Drivers license Class
A commitment to work within Calvary’s Mission, Vision and Values
Experience using power tools and garden maintenance equipment
